The Prospector neighborhood in Park City is one of the older residential developments in Park City with the subdivisions of of Prospector Square, Prospector Village and Prospector Park dating back to the 1970's although some homes have continued being built right through the 80's, 90's and 2000's.   Chatham Hills is a newer and pricier subdivision in the Prospector area with most of the homes being a fair amount larger than others in the Prospector area and built out largely after the turn of the century. The Prospector area offers the convenience of a close to town location.  You can be at Park City Mountain Resort, Deer Valley or anywhere downtown in just a matter of minutes. Who doesn't like a great sale? Right now you can get most Park City or Deer Valley ski condos at prices from 20-40% lower than you would have paid at the peak of the market in 2007. While home prices for single family homes in Park City have rebounded strongly and in some cases approached the levels seen before the bust, ski condos are still languishing well below peak pricing. I think it is typical when we come out of a recession for pent up demand for items we "need", like a place to live, to be among the first sectors of the economy to recover.  A ski condo is typically not a need but a want, and is in the category of discretionary spending, more of a luxury item. Deer Valley Resort opened for business in December of 1981 and now in it's 23rd year, boasts skiing on 21 lifts and 100 marked runs.  There are also 7 bowl areas and chutes available for advanced and expert skiers.  Deer Valley was once known only for it's groomed corduroy runs but with the expansion into Empire Canyon a number of years ago there are some true expert areas to keep almost any expert skier busy and happy for the day. Most of the improvements over the summer will not necessarily be visible to the naked eye but there has been improvements to the food service at the Empire Lodge as well as snow making and a new trail cut as well. Last week I had the opportunity to sit in on Rick Klein's third quarter real estate update and presentation, and as usual it was filled with useful information.  Rick is a Private Mortgage Banker for Wells Fargo and always does a great job interpreting the numbers. Here are a few of the highlights: Pended sales have been trending up since early 2009 but have clearly accelerated over the past 9 months.  Every month of 2013 has seen higher pended sales than the same month in 2012 and the Pended Home Sales Index is at it's highest level since September 2006.   The Greater Park City Area saw an increase of 6% in the rolling three month average of existing home sales and September's number was 36% higher than September 2012, illustrating the acceleration. The first three quarters of 2013 are now in the books (we can’t believe that ski season is only a month away!).  Park City real estate sales for the first 3/4th of the year have been very strong. Sales volume is up and so are prices while inventory is down. Single family home sales in the greater Park City area are up eighteen percent (18%) when compared with the first three quarters of 2012. The median sales price of Park City, UT homes sold in 2013 is up by over $60,000 to $810,000. Inventory levels continue to be a big part of the story. Single family home sales under $500K have a current less than 3 month supply while homes in the $500-750K category have less than 4 months’ supply at current sales rates.
